Marywood Opens CSAC Play With 1-0 Win Over GMC

Scranton, PA - Siobhan Blancaflor picked up her team leading third goal of the season just over a minute into the second half off an assist from Erin Jones and Marywood held off a short-handed Gwynedd-Mercy team to open CSAC play with a 1-0 win over the Griffins Tuesday afternoon in Scranton.  Marywood moves to 4-2-1 overall while the Griffins, who played nearly 75 minutes a man-down due to a red card, slip to 2-5-1 (0-1 CSAC).

After a back and forth opening ten minutes, a red card was issued to a Gwynedd-Mercy player at the 13:20 mark and forced the Griffins to play a man down the remainder of the game.  Despite playing with nine field players, GMC still got several good looks at the goal in each half.

The Griffin defense kept the Pacers off the board in the first half, but a series of one-time passes nearly two minutes into the second half resulted in Blancaflor's game-winner.  Emma Nye (Keene, NY) checked back to receive a ball in the midfield and laid a one-time pass to Erin Jones (Vestal, NY) on the right flank.  Jones one-timed the ball into a streaking Blancaflor (Haddam, CT) who promptly deposited the ball past GMC keeper Kristie Pollock.

From there, the Marywood defense picked up its second consecutive shutout thanks to several nice saves from goalkeeper Meghan Coyle (Endicott, NY) and strong play by backs Shannon Hresko (Gibbstown, NJ), Andrea Barker (Binghamton, NY), Paige Madary (Royersford, PA) and Lacey Habicht (Woodcliff Lake, NJ).  Coyle stoned GMC forward Gwen Conte with about six minutes remaining at the top of the 18-yard box to prevent a breakaway game-tying goal.

Marywood, who out-shot the Griffins 14-6 on the day, returns to action Saturday against defending CSAC Champion Cabrini College.  Kick-off in Radnor is set for 1:30 pm .
